IUQD invests in stocks. The fund's major sectors are Technology Services, with 25.36% stocks, and Electronic Technology, with 21.20% of the basket. The assets are mostly located in the North America region.
IUQD top holdings are NVIDIA Corporation and Apple Inc., occupying 7.50% and 7.05% of the portfolio correspondingly.
IUQD last dividends amounted to 8.91 USD. Six months before that, the issuer paid 8.93 USD in dividends, which shows a 0.22% decrease.
IUQD assets under management is 242.38 M USD. It's fallen 13.59% over the last month.
IUQD fund flows account for −598.80 M USD (1 year). Many traders use this metric to get insight into investors' sentiment and evaluate whether it's time to buy or sell the fund.
Yes, IUQD pays dividends to its holders with the dividend yield of 0.77%. The last dividend (Jun 25, 2025) amounted to 8.91 USD. The dividends are paid semi-annually.
IUQD shares are issued by BlackRock, Inc. under the brand iShares. The ETF was launched on Feb 21, 2018, and its management style is Passive.
IUQD expense ratio is 0.20% meaning you'd have to pay 0.20% of your investment to help manage the fund.
IUQD follows the MSCI USA Sector Neutral Quality. ETFs usually track some benchmark seeking to replicate its performance and guide asset selection and objectives.
